Do Not Use For:
Gases, vapors, including those
present in paint spraying operations,
oil aerosols, asbestos, arsenic,
cadmium, lead, 4,4'-methylenedianiline
(MDA) or sandblasting. Aerosol
concentrations that exceed 10 times
the OSHA PEL, or applicable
exposure limits, whichever is
lower. This respirator does not
supply oxygen.

Time Use Limitation
If respirator becomes damaged,
soiled, or breathing becomes
difficult, leave the contaminated
area immediately and replace
the respirator.
